You are on page 1of 6

Page 1 of 6

KRANTHI KUMAR GOLI


Contact # 408-991-5735
Email id # imgkranthi@yahoo.com

SUMMARY
Worked as a Software Quality Assurance Engineer for over 11+ years with diversified experience in
Manual and Automated testing of software projects. Well conversant with all phases of software testing
lifecycle.

 Over 11+ years of solid QA experience encompassing design, development, maintenance and
implementation of total Quality Assurance methodologies and processes.
 Extensive experience in build and release processes, Quality Assurance Life Cycle (QALC) & Software
Development Life Cycle (SDLC), from Requirement analysis to System Testing.
 Extensive experience in preparing Test Cases, Test Scripts, Test Reports and Documentation for
both Manual and Automated Tests.
 Expertise in Manual Testing and Automated Testing using the tools such as QTP for functional test
automation and Bridge Tool for Performance test automation.
 Expertise in using Bug-Tracking tools such as JIRA with a thorough understanding of all the reporting
features.
 Developed automation scripts using Selenium Web Driver, Eclipse, JUnit and Java.
 Developed re-usable function using JUnit for the Test Automation.
 Worked on creating test case for Object -driven framework for selenium WebDriver.
 Involved in automating test cases using Selenium Web Driver with TestNG.
 Extensively used Selenium IDE to record, playback and debug individual test cases, using Selenium
Web Driver provided more flexibility in automating test cases.
 Used automated scripts and performed functionality testing during the various phases of the
application development using Selenium IDE.
 Performed Integration and Regression testing to check compatibility of new functionality with the
existing functionalities of the application using Selenium.
 Experience in Test Planning, Effort Estimation, Designing, Execution and Reporting.
 Experience in functionality, performance, GUI, installation, backend, data migration, compatibility
and regression testing.
 Experience in creating and managing the Test Environments for manual, functional automation and
performance automation testing.
 Experienced in performing business function tests at various stages of the project like build
verification, Integration, System, Security, User acceptance and Regression which includes Black box,
Positive and Negative testing.
 Possessing excellent technical and problem solving skills, strong interpersonal skills and a quick
learner.

TECHNICAL SKILLS
Languages: JAVA, .Net, Visual Basic, C++, SQL, PL/SQL, COBOL.
Scripting Languages: HTML, DHTML, XML, XSLT, SOAP UI, VB Script and Java Script
Testing Tools: Win Runner, Quality Center, Load Runner 11.0, Quick Test
Professional, Base24, Bridge Tool, Tandem, JIRA, and Bugzilla
Srinivasa Raavi Voice: (845) 473 1137 X 353 Fax: 845 473 1197
www.iic.com 331 Main Street, Poughkeepsie, NY - 12601 Email: raavi@iic.com
Page 2 of 6
GUI: Visual Basic (6.0/5.0)
RDBMS: MS SQL Server 7.0, MS-Access, Oracle 8.x
Tools: MS Visual Studio, MS Visual Source Safe, MS Visual Interdev 6.0
and .NET
Operating Systems: MS-DOS, Windows -98/2000/Professional/XP-Pro, NT, UNIX.
ERP: PeopleSoft

Education: B.E from BITS in Electronics and Communication Engineering,


JNTU, India and also Masters in Computer Science.

PROFESSIONAL EXPERIENCE

McKesson, Charlotte, NC 07/15- Till Date


QA Team Lead
Description: Paragon Ambulatory is a Clinical documentation solution for outpatient medical offices and
hospital clinics within Paragon Ambulatory EHR. It provides physician’s a method of documenting visits
in an easy to use streamlined manner.

Responsibilities:
 Involved in creating and execution of test plans for their Internet web site application.
 Analyzed the Business Requirements and System Specifications and worked on test plan, test
cases, test data, test scripts in order to carry out testing process.
 Used Quick Test Professional to execute automation test cases after manually verifying
application functionalities.
 Involved in developing policies and procedures to ensure web site release integrity.
 Inserted Synchronization, Standard, Bitmap and Image checkpoints for greater accuracy of
testing in Quick Test Professional (QTP).
 Involved in Functionality testing of the web based application by testing various modules of the
application using Quick Test Professional (QTP).
 Conducted automated parameterization of dynamic content, multiple data sets within
application by using Quick Test Professional (QTP).
 Inserted Synchronization, Standard, Bitmap and Image checkpoints for greater accuracy of
testing in Quick Test Professional (QTP).
 Involved in Functionality testing of the web based application by testing various modules of the
application using Quick Test Professional (QTP).
 Conducted automated parameterization of dynamic content, multiple data sets within
application by using Quick Test Professional (QTP).
 Wrote SQL Query to extract data from various database tables for testing purpose
 Used TOAD for SQL Query to validate the Integrity of Test Data.
 Developed automation scripts using Selenium WebDriver, Eclipse, JUnit and Java.
 Developed re-usable function using JUnit for the Test Automation.
 Worked on creating test case for Object -driven framework for selenium Web Driver.
 Extensively used Selenium IDE to record, playback and debug individual test cases, using Sele-
nium Web Driver provided more flexibility in automating test cases.

Srinivasa Raavi Voice: (845) 473 1137 X 353 Fax: 845 473 1197
www.iic.com 331 Main Street, Poughkeepsie, NY - 12601 Email: raavi@iic.com
Page 3 of 6
 Used automated scripts and performed functionality testing during the various phases of the ap-
plication development using Selenium IDE.
 Performed Integration and Regression testing to check compatibility of new functionality with
the existing functionalities of the application using Selenium.
 Checked functional test cases and technical specifications.
 Created Test cases for functionalities and automated the bug free test cases for Regression
Testing.
 Using test specs and test frames created, automated the test cases writing TSL scripts using Win
Runner.

 Performed different types of testing like build verification, Integration, System, Regression.
 Executed Error Handling and Exception cases.
 Verified the images to make sure that they are loading properly.
 Worked with development team to ensure that testing issues are resolved.

Environment: Selenium Web Driver, Java, TestNG, SQL, Web Services, SOAP UI, Restful, DHTML,
Quality center, HTML, Oracle11g, MSWord, MS Excel, PL/SQL Developer, UNIX, Windows 7.

Accenture/Bank of America, Charlotte, NC 02/10 to 06/15


QA Analyst /Environment Lead
Description: This application gives customer access to their accounts through the ATM Channel.
Customers can check their account balance, view accounts activity, pay bills, transfer funds/balances
from other accounts, credit cards, home equity, personal loans, education financing services. Video
Teller Machine (VTM) combines traditional ATM capabilities and video conferencing capabilities with
people interaction to perform routine banking transactions. VTM represents a new service model that
provides customer with “Electronic” face-to-face interaction when required or as requested by the
customer while performing the ATM transaction.
Responsibilities:
 Analyzed Business Requirements specifications and Design Documents.
 Worked closely with the Business Analysts to make sure all the functionality in the application meets
the Business Specifications.
 Software test planning and execution, primarily functioning in integration test capacity.
 Responsible for helping test a variety of ATA VTA products and assisting testing a related product
when necessary. Responsibilities include test plans, test cases, test execution, test reports, opening
and verifying work requests/bug reports, and helping recreate customer issues.
 Primary engineer responsible for automated test design, frontend and backend feature
implementation, and any other improvements to the test automation framework.
 Work closely with other testers and developers to improve automated framework with bug fixes
and feature requests.
 Responsible for security standard implementation.
 Participated in the full SDLC, including requirement analysis, design, implementation, and
development.
 Actively participated in daily Agile Scrum Meetings and discussed the feasibility of new
enhancements and made effective UAT deliverables to stakeholders.
 Developed test cases to verify the functionality of the system based on the system's functional
Srinivasa Raavi Voice: (845) 473 1137 X 353 Fax: 845 473 1197
www.iic.com 331 Main Street, Poughkeepsie, NY - 12601 Email: raavi@iic.com
Page 4 of 6
requirements (stories)
 Accountable for the final customer experience resulting from the projects engaged.
 Single point of contact leading testing for multiple large projects.
 Accountable and participated in all phases of testing deliverable including planning, data
conditioning, script creation, script execution, defect identification and resolution, implementation
support.
 Identified, communicated and remediate risk to successful completion of the project.
 Involved in building a new ATM/ATA with Re-images which Includes USB Build and Tivoli Build.
 Lead in weekly status meetings, walkthroughs and documented the proceedings.
 Performed Database testing extensively to verify the impact of front – end operations on database
tables.
 Performed System testing, Regression testing, Security testing, usability testing and performance
testing of the various requirements.
 Involved in Black Box testing and Integration testing of the application along with the developers.
 The Black Box validation (testing) method is used by selecting valid and invalid input and
determines the correct output.
 Involved in entire testing process including Functional testing, Integration, and User
acceptance testing.
 Worked extensively with the offshore and onsite team which involved various application teams and
has an ability to handle a team of people in the project.
 Attended Status reporting meeting to update team members about the project status.
 Worked closely with the Development team in getting fixes for the defects that have been in open
status.
 Participated in Meetings from analysis phase to till UAT.

Environment: QC, Base24, Bridge Tool, Tandem, ATM/ATA/LTA/Next Gen Machines/ Target
Application, DMART.

Consulate General of India, SFO, CA 02/08 to 12/09


Sr. QA Engineer
Description This application gives customer access to their online application through the Internet.
Customers can check their Passport Status, PIO Card, OCI Card and Visa Information.
Responsibilities:
 Analyzed the user requirements by interacting with users, developers and business analysts.
 Created Test Plans, test cases and test procedures that ensure the product adheres to the application
requirements.
 Conducted Functional, Security, User Interface, Regression testing and UAT on the AUT.
 Performed browser compatibility testing on different platforms.
 Involved in backend testing using SQL queries to verify data integrity.
 Attended weekly status meetings to update the team members the progress in testing.
 Parameterized the test scripts and performed Data driven Testing with different sets of input data
using Win Runner.
 Developed and/or reviewed all black-box test cases for critical SQL Server based reporting
component of SEP 11.0, establishing a solid suite of test cases that required little to no updates
while testing against initial requirements.
 Executed the test cases and analyzed the test results using Win Runner.
Srinivasa Raavi Voice: (845) 473 1137 X 353 Fax: 845 473 1197
www.iic.com 331 Main Street, Poughkeepsie, NY - 12601 Email: raavi@iic.com
Page 5 of 6
 Designed data for interpreting negative/positive results.
 Extensively used Load Runner for performance testing and measuring the response time of the
application under different load conditions.
 Follow up with the developers on defects status on a daily basis.
Environment: Win Runner, Load Runner, Windows NT, MS-Access, VB.

MetLife Insurance Co. NY 01/07 to 12/08


QA Engineer
Description: Worked as a QA Engineer on a web-based e-commerce application accessed by potential
customers to buy Insurance products, get free Rate Quote and Report accidents via their website. Customer
inputs his personal information to obtain a rate quote. Information is then processed using SSL to add
security when sending data over the Internet. Encrypting the data before it leaves the computer does this.
The loss reporting allows policyholders to report their accidents through Internet. Customer enters some
basic information, including policy number and contact information. Once customer has entered the
information, they receive confirmation e-mail, letting them know that their claim has been entered into
Internet Reporting System.
Responsibilities:
 Support the projects with Effort Estimation, Project scheduling and Re-scheduling, Risk Tracking,
Decision Analysis, Defect Management, usage of Metrics to track Projects.
 Verification and tracking of all projects to ascertain process compliance.
 Responsible for driving initiatives in job skill competency building for the team members.
 Review the Requirement Specification and Functional Specification.
 Creation of the Project plan, Test plan and Master Test plan.
 Allocation of work within the QA team.
 Win Runner was used to generate automated test scripts for functionality and GUI testing and
further enhancements were done in the script.
 Defined automated test scripts using QTP tool and maintained in the Quality Center.
 Performed regression testing for every modification in the application and new builds using Win
Runner.
 Expertise in Black box Testing techniques like BVA,ECP, Decision tables and User Case Testing
 The Black Box validation (testing) method is used by selecting valid and invalid input and
determines the correct output
 Executed different SQL queries to ensure data integrity.
 Assisted in documenting the user manual for end users.
 Work closely with Test analysts to ensure test environment and data readiness.
 Responsible to ensure that automated script repository is properly maintained and that all test
processes are fully documented.
 Participated in design, use case reviews and quality inspections for each release.
 Attended Status reporting meeting to update team members about the project status.
 Worked closely with the Development team in getting fixes for the defects that have been in open
status.
 Participated in Meetings from analysis phase to till UAT.
Environment: Win Runner, J2EE, XML, VB, VBScript, Oracle, Selenium Tool /SOAP UI, SQL SERVER 7.0
& 2000Win NT

Robert Bosch India limited, India 10/05 to 10/06


Srinivasa Raavi Voice: (845) 473 1137 X 353 Fax: 845 473 1197
www.iic.com 331 Main Street, Poughkeepsie, NY - 12601 Email: raavi@iic.com
Page 6 of 6
Software Quality Consultant
Description: A general-purpose packages (2 tier) for Payroll Management using MS Access as the back-
end to store data and Visual Basic 6.0 as the front-end tool. It covered different aspects like Employee
Personal details, Employment details, Salary, Allowances and Deductions, Leave Details, Net salary
calculation etc. Given the employee gross salary, net salary was calculated taking into account the
medical insurance, taxes deductions, etc.
Responsibilities:
 Involved as Team member in designing and coding.
 Participated in user Requirement analysis.
 Involved in test plan preparation.
 Prepared Test Cases.
 Performed Unit and Integration testing.
 Mapped the Requirements to the Test Cases using the Requirement Traceability Matrix.
 Tested the functionality of each screen to monitor proper navigation.
 Responsible for GUI and Compatibility testing.
 Conducted Positive and Negative tests.
 Responsible for back end testing to verify and validate data by using TOAD.
 Regression tests were performed after every build of the application.
 Responsible for Installation, configuration of Hardware and Software.
Environment: Win runner, Manual Testing, Visual Basic 6.0, MS Access, Windows 98/NT.

Tata Elxsi Ltd, India 11/04 to 10/05


Software Quality Engineer
Description: Complete Business solution for the specified client in automating their activities of all the
branches of Super Market as it has a chain of 100 retail outlet super markets all over the State. By
making it as an online transaction for all the branches and avoiding the involvement of manual process
in generating right from procurement to the distribution i.e., converting into sale of goods, maintaining
the Inventory for about more than 15,000 products and for all the major activities of Trinethra Super
Market.
Responsibilities:
 Involved in development and implementation of Test cases, Test data, Test scripts and documented
Test plan and prerequisites.
 Performed Manual GUI Testing for EIS until the application is stabilized. Performed Regression
which includes Positive and Negative testing, Production Checkout testing, Boundary testing,
Browser compatibility testing and Usability testing for the GUI screens, System Testing, User Guide
Testing.
 Debugged the test scripts, performed regression tests, verifying the test results and reported the
defects.
 Tracked all the bugs found during regression and system testing.
 Worked with the functional documents and made sure that defects were logged against the
documents during planning.
 Identified critical test cases and provided guidance to identify the test cases based on the
requirements provided by the Analysis and Architecture team.
Environment: Manual Testing, Java, JSP and Oracle.

Srinivasa Raavi Voice: (845) 473 1137 X 353 Fax: 845 473 1197
www.iic.com 331 Main Street, Poughkeepsie, NY - 12601 Email: raavi@iic.com

You might also like